This is another run of the Coccinelle script for converting kmalloc()
family of allocations to kmalloc_obj() via the existing rules in
scripts/coccinelle/api/kmalloc_objs.cocci

This catches both the set of kmalloc() uses added since the first
kmalloc_obj() conversions in v7.0 and adds a large group missed in the
first pass due to Coccinelle not interacting well with the cleanup.h
scoped_...() family of macros[1]. I worked around this with spatch's
"--macro-file" argument to a file with all the scoped_...() macros mapped
to Coccinelle's YACFE_ITERATOR[2] as that was the closest viable control
flow indicator I could find.

Build tested allmodconfig on x86, arm64, arm, loongarch, mips, powerpc,
riscv, and s390 with no new warnings.

<title>ACPI: APEI: GHES: Bound AER info copy and sanitize software metadata</title>

ghes_handle_aer() copies sizeof(struct aer_capability_regs) out of the
fixed 96-byte pcie_err-&gt;aer_info. The struct is larger, so the copy reads
past the section, and it fills the software-only header_len and flit fields
of the embedded struct pcie_tlp_log from firmware bytes.
pcie_print_tlp_log() uses both to bound a loop over dw[], so a large value
walks past the array. Nothing checks the section can hold a struct
cper_sec_pcie either.

Validate error_data_length, zero the destination, and map aer_info onto the
struct as extlog_print_pcie() does: copy up to the four Header Log DWORDs,
then place the TLP Prefix Log from its own offset. The rest stays zero,
covering header_len and flit.

<title>ACPI: APEI: GHES: Validate memory error section length before payload access</title>

ghes_do_proc() hands the CPER_SEC_PLATFORM_MEM payload to the report chain,
arch_apei_report_mem_error() and ghes_handle_memory_failure() without
checking gdata-&gt;error_data_length. All three read validation_bits and
physical_addr, at offsets 0 and 16, so a shorter section reads past the
record.

Check the length once in ghes_do_proc(), before any consumer runs. Take the
73-byte struct cper_sec_mem_err_old as the floor: older firmware
legitimately emits that UEFI 2.1/2.2 layout, and it makes validation_bits
safe to read.

The fields from "extended" on are absent from that layout, so also require
whatever length the validation bits claim. Derive it per field rather than
demanding the full 80 bytes: rank needs only 76, and the BANK_GROUP and
BANK_ADDRESS bits describe "bank" at offset 38, which every record carries.
Testing the whole mask against one size, as cper_print_mem() does, gets it
wrong both ways.

cxl_cper_setup_prot_err_work_data() locates the RAS Capability block at
prot_err + sizeof(*prot_err) + dvsec_len and copies it, but dvsec_len is
firmware controlled and never validated, so it can point the copy outside
the section.

Extend cxl_cper_sec_prot_err_valid() to check that the section can hold
the header, and that the header, DVSEC and RAS Capability block together
fit the reported section length.

cxl_cper_post_event() copies a fixed sizeof(struct cxl_cper_event_rec)
out of the firmware CPER section without checking how long the section
actually is, so a short one reads past the record.

Pass gdata-&gt;error_data_length in and reject a section too small to hold
the record before the copy.

The guard reads "#ifdef ACPI_APEI_PCIEAER" rather than
"#ifdef CONFIG_ACPI_APEI_PCIEAER". That symbol is never defined, so the
extlog PCIe AER handling is always compiled out.

Use the CONFIG_ prefixed symbol.

extlog_print_pcie() reads pcie_err-&gt;validation_bits and device_id and
copies the 96-byte aer_info buffer without checking that
gdata-&gt;error_data_length is big enough for a struct cper_sec_pcie. The
cper_estatus_check() call added earlier keeps the read inside the estatus
block, but a short section still gets stale adjacent bytes treated as PCIe
error data.

Reject a section too small to hold the record before touching any field,
and warn: a truncated section means firmware is emitting malformed records.

extlog_print_pcie() casts pcie_err-&gt;aer_info straight to struct
aer_capability_regs *. That struct embeds struct pcie_tlp_log, whose
software-only header_len and flit fields sit at offset 84 - inside the
96-byte aer_info buffer - so the cast fills them with raw firmware bytes.
pcie_print_tlp_log() uses both to bound a loop over dw[], and a large
header_len walks past the end of the array.

Copy into a zeroed local struct, and only as far as aer_info maps onto it:
the leading registers and the four Header Log DWORDs. Place the TLP Prefix
Log separately, from the offset the hardware keeps it at. The rest stays
zero, which covers header_len and flit and keeps the Root Error registers
out of the prefix log, where pcie_print_tlp_log() would print them as
end-to-end prefixes.

extlog_print() calls cxl_cper_handle_prot_err() synchronously while the
MCE notifier chain rwsem is held, and that path takes the PCI device_lock
via guard(device)(). The probe path takes the two in the opposite order,
holding device_lock while mce_register_decode_chain() takes the rwsem, so
they can deadlock AB-BA.

ghes.c already avoids this by posting protocol errors to a kfifo and
handling them from a workqueue via cxl_cper_post_prot_err(). Export that
function and call it instead.

Declare it with the other CONFIG_ACPI_APEI_GHES exports rather than at the
end of the header. No #else stub: ACPI_EXTLOG selects ACPI_APEI_GHES, so
the only caller cannot exist without it.
